JohnR 04-21-2005, 04:43 PM My son has some minor abdominal issues and had surgery this morning - so far all seems a success. We are happy and releived.
I am very impressed with the staff at Hasbro. Everyone has been awesome. There was a meeting Wednesday that had the families and patients to be doing a walk-thru on what would happen on the day of the surgery - very informative and an obvious key to making my son at ease today (and me and the boss).
The staff was awesome, from the nurses to doctors and even the parking attendant (OK, maybe that was just the law of averages kicking in). It was a well oiled team that treated my son with respect and a smile....
